Output d3f3e22f54a30a6e8a43f2f0eebe9acf272458a28b5c4b6eaae65d0202c5eee6:0

value
25715135
script pubkey
OP_0 OP_PUSHBYTES_20 dd16c0fe0bfa936dddca2a214941753887d10ba7
address
bc1qm5tvplstl2fkmhw29gs5jst48zrazza84pnwvq
transaction
d3f3e22f54a30a6e8a43f2f0eebe9acf272458a28b5c4b6eaae65d0202c5eee6
confirmations
132238
spent
true